Output efdcb235b1f697adc3c0156efe898fd8cfa088298669150e6f04e00dae23a94e:7

value
657303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d167e806be5e6fef51493d8bd8dc4888400f1b2 OP_EQUAL
address
37G26AbAsj8FdnSJhvgBKeGJpE6SFVqbLF
transaction
efdcb235b1f697adc3c0156efe898fd8cfa088298669150e6f04e00dae23a94e
spent
false

6 Sat Ranges